12 cool restaurants and bars for Christmas parties in Liverpool

9 months ago

Party season is coming, and while some super-organised folks have had their end-of-year do sorted since July, the rest of us are searching around for the best options. To save you some leg-work, we’ve brought together 12 places for Christmas parties in Liverpool that you can rely on to deliver a brilliant celebration.

From cool, casual bars like Almost Famous and Seven Bro7hers, to luxurious, glam restaurants like San Carlo and Restaurant Bar & Grill, we’ve got options to suit all tastes. Just make sure you book as soon as possible; these places will fill up fast.

    The Restaurant Bar & Grill Liverpool

    Bars

    With its six foot chandelier and gold leaf ceiling Restaurant Bar & Grill Liverpool is one of the city’s most spectacular dining settings. A £500k refurbishment in 2021 brought to life the original features of this Grade II Listed heritage building. Now it’s one of the most photogenic backdrops in Liverpool, and the food’s not half bad too.
